If you find you need to do more when you’re already too busy, here are some tips:
1) Too many customers and orders all at once.
Before you turn some of them away to your competitors, consider calling each one to prioritize the work. The least critical ones for delivery can perhaps be delayed.
The slow year means that you can’t turn away any client or you’ll go bankrupt. So offer a small discount for a slower delivery, or simply ask them for an extension.
2) Find an efficiency expert in your field.
The very first instinct is to hire some people. But in a rush and during the holiday period, of course you can’t find anyone who can be helpful right off the bat. There’s no time to train the newbie.
Hiring and efficiency expert sounds easier and more expensive than it sounds right? Actually if you think outside the ‘expert advice’ box for a moment you will and can find the right experts. You’ll remember your networking with many people and you can start calling for leads for the experts to help you in your field.
A retired person with experience in your field can be invaluable. They have tips and tricks from years of experience. Use them. He or she may be an aunt or uncle or simply retired and known to a friend. Many years of experience is the true expertise. You’ll be playing Saint Nicholas too.
